Abstract:

This paper presents the modelling of a power electronic system using SIMULINK software. The power electronic system is a bi-directional DC/DC conversion system consisting of two three-phase voltage source converters linked by an ac link. A simple switching transfer function method is used to model the voltage source converters (VSC). A current controller and a voltage controller are respectively used for the two VSC. The model of the power electronic system has been constructed in SIMULINK. The performance of the system has been studied. It has been demonstrated that SIMULINK can effectively be used for power electronic system studies.
